The table shows the height of water in a pool as it is being filled. A table showing Height of Water in a Pool with two columns
icang [17]

Answer:

The height of the water increases 2 inches per minute.

Step-by-step explanation:

the slope is always the ratio of

y coordinate change / x coordinate change

in our case, x is the time (minutes), and y is the water height (inches).

we see, the longer the pool get filled, the higher the water gets. logical, right ?

by checking the data points we see :

with every 2 minutes passing the water height increases by 4 inches.

so, the slope is +4/+2 = 2/1 = 2

and that ratio tells us now the increase of the water height with every fraction or multiple of the measured 2-minute interval.

every 2 minutes 4 inches more.

so, e.g. every 3×2 = 6 minutes we get 3×4 = 12 inches more.

and - every 1/2 × 2 = 1 minute more we get 1/2 × 4 = 2 inches more.
